Why it matters
Less debt, the less you need to retire
Every dollar of debt in retirement is a dollar of income you have to find before you've spent a cent on living. Clear the debt, and the number you need to retire on comes down: your savings stretch further, and the money that was servicing a loan becomes money you can actually live on.
It also takes the pressure off in the years when markets wobble. With no repayments hanging over you, you're not forced to sell investments at the wrong moment just to cover them. Fewer bills, fewer worries, more of your money doing what you want it to.
How we go about it
A plan, not a crash diet
A clear target date
We start from when you'd like to retire and work backwards, so the plan fits the timeframe you actually have — realistic and achievable, not a vague someday.
A sensible order
Debts paid down in the order that does the most good, step by step, within what you can comfortably afford — built around your real income and your real life, so it's a plan you keep up and finish, not one that runs out of steam.
Tax-effective, and early
We use the tax concessions super offers to free up tax savings — then put those savings to work paying your debt down, across several financial years rather than one. It's a big reason starting early matters: the sooner you begin, the more those savings can do.

Common questions
The things people ask
Should I pay off my mortgage before I retire?
For many people, clearing the mortgage first means less stress and less capital needed to retire comfortably. But it does depend on your full picture — the right order and timing is what we help you work out. (This is general information, not personal advice.)
What if I can't clear all my debt in time?
Even reducing it makes a real difference to what you need and how relaxed retirement feels. We work to a realistic plan within your timeframe and resources — progress, not perfection.
Is it ever worth keeping some debt into retirement?
Sometimes your circumstances point that way, and that's fine. The aim isn't a rule that suits everyone — it's the right answer for you, with eyes open to what the debt costs you.
